An Act designating September as PCOS awareness month
Filed by Samantha Montaño · 5 cosponsors · 194th General Court · the legislature's own page
H3392 · Bill · docket HD767
9 actions
In the order the legislature recorded them.
| Date | Branch | Action |
|---|
| 2025-02-27 | House | Referred to the committee on State Administration and Regulatory Oversight |
| 2025-02-27 | Senate | Senate concurred |
| 2025-05-30 | Joint | Hearing scheduled for 06/04/2025 from 11:00 AM-05:00 PM in Gardner Auditorium |
| 2025-08-18 | House | Bill reported favorably by committee and referred to the committee on House Steering, Policy and Scheduling |
| 2025-09-08 | House | Committee reported that the matter be placed in the Orders of the Day for the next sitting |
| 2025-09-08 | House | Rules suspended |
| 2025-09-08 | House | Read second and ordered to a third reading |
| 2025-09-15 | House | Read third, amended and passed to be engrossed |
| 2025-09-18 | Senate | Read; and referred to the committee on Senate Rules |
